Abstract
Objective To discuss the causes and preventive methods of secondary hemorrhage after Uvulopalatopharyngoplasty(UPPP).Methods 476 UPPP procedures,performed from August 2002 to December 2010,were reviewed according to the Windfuhr J bleeding classification system.Results 26 patients suffered from postoperative bleeding,including 17 cases of secondary bleeding.We found that grade 1 bleeding occurred in 5 cases(1%),grade 2 in 7 cases(1.47%),grade 3 in 2 cases(0.42%),grade 4 in 3 cases(0.63%) and there was no grade 5 bleeding.The causes of secondary hemorrhage included failed suture in the operation,poorly controlled blood pressure,postoperative cough,and wound infection.All patients were cured with proper treatment.Conclusion According to our findings,it is important to decide surgical hemostatic intervention in time.Preventing secondary postoperative hemorrhage can be achieved by proper measures.
